Output 521819859773c31edeafd928135eee2cca86338f53cfe60ac1b95cc7671123c5:140

value
19394
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0beafb88bf3f7a5c78356382a02087001bbd3e29f3f3c243b9863b4cf2b7d4f2
address
bc1pp040hz9l8aa9c7p4vwp2qgy8qqdm603f70euysaesca5eu4h6neqec2tta
transaction
521819859773c31edeafd928135eee2cca86338f53cfe60ac1b95cc7671123c5
spent
true